Critical bug in NAV 2013 R2 can cause data loss!
Kowa
Member Posts: 926
A severe bug in NAV 2013 R2 can lead to data loss in these scenarios:
Full article: http://blogs.msdn.com/b/nav/archive/2014/02/28/important-information-potential-data-loss-in-nav2013r2.aspxMSDN NAV Blog wrote:You may experience data loss in Microsoft Dynamics NAV 2013 R2 in the following situations, separately or in combination:
•Changing an application object more than once, for example by two different developers, in the same database connected to the same Microsoft Dynamics NAV Server instance while users are working in the system.
•Compiling all application objects, and thereby potentially changing objects more than once, in a database that is connected to a Microsoft Dynamics NAV Server instance that users are accessing.
[…]
Kai Kowalewski
0
Comments
-
"You must compile objects only when no users are working in the system, including users connecting through NAS."
In my opinion it's a quite restrictive constraint, what do you think about?
Moreover I'm thinking about databases with 24/7 (like my production ones) web services, need to be stopped as well?* Daniele Rebussi * | * Rebu NAV Diary *0 -
It means that the developers can only work off hours and clients will have to wait for their mission critical updates. :roll:Confessions of a Dynamics NAV Consultant = my blog
AP Commerce, Inc. = where I work
Getting Started with Dynamics NAV 2013 Application Development = my book
Implementing Microsoft Dynamics NAV - 3rd Edition = my 2nd book0 -
It also means there is a big disconnect between Microsoft marketing and development.
Marketing wants to target NAV to smaller companies - who typically want their changes done on the fly and developers / consultants backup and restore companies because it is quick because of size.
Development wants to put in more big company controls suitable to large ERP implementations.
Maybe marketing and development should get together and agree on direction.
If they had told us at Directions that backup and restore company was going away plus the ability to make changes to live installs, they would have had a strong negative response.David Machanick
http://mibuso.com/blogs/davidmachanick/0 -
* Daniele Rebussi * | * Rebu NAV Diary *0
-
The bug is fixed and the hotfix can be downloaded from partnersource https://mbs2.microsoft.com/Knowledgebas ... US;2934571
However, just because NAV allows you to make changes to a live system doesn’t mean that a Developer should.
Bug or no bug we’d never recommend modifying a system whilst users are in the system.
If you have users or a NAS on the system and you modify it they will keep running on old versions of application objects from the cache and they will continue doing it until the objects get out of scope, which for a NAS could mean never or until the NST is restarted.This posting is provided "AS IS" with no warranties, and confers no rights.0
Categories
- All Categories
- 73 General
- 73 Announcements
- 66.7K Microsoft Dynamics NAV
- 18.8K NAV Three Tier
- 38.4K NAV/Navision Classic Client
- 3.6K Navision Attain
- 2.4K Navision Financials
- 116 Navision DOS
- 851 Navision e-Commerce
- 1K NAV Tips & Tricks
- 772 NAV Dutch speaking only
- 617 NAV Courses, Exams & Certification
- 2K Microsoft Dynamics-Other
- 1.5K Dynamics AX
- 327 Dynamics CRM
- 111 Dynamics GP
- 10 Dynamics SL
- 1.5K Other
- 990 SQL General
- 383 SQL Performance
- 34 SQL Tips & Tricks
- 35 Design Patterns (General & Best Practices)
- 1 Architectural Patterns
- 10 Design Patterns
- 5 Implementation Patterns
- 53 3rd Party Products, Services & Events
- 1.6K General
- 1.1K General Chat
- 1.6K Website
- 83 Testing
- 1.2K Download section
- 23 How Tos section
- 252 Feedback
- 12 NAV TechDays 2013 Sessions
- 13 NAV TechDays 2012 Sessions
